Lutheran Services is a not-for-profit organization with a proud 90-year history of providing exceptional care and support to communities across Queensland. With 11 residential aged care facilities, we are dedicated to enhancing the quality of life for our residents while upholding our values of compassion, integrity, and excellence.
Our services extend beyond aged care to include retirement living, home care, disability support, mental health, and family services, always placing the wellbeing of our residents and clients at the heart of everything we do.
